Output 8c7984ff51e1e19829bc5a22602a9c1b7e557604f905145191fcfe83635f30ab:1

value
351536753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ae447dd223552294950f1c52e3b330edfd65a37a OP_EQUAL
address
3HaTYo25brBhs6Eq2hHYdkGHMhVWwsp4ug
transaction
8c7984ff51e1e19829bc5a22602a9c1b7e557604f905145191fcfe83635f30ab
spent
true